Georg Rainer Hofmann

Georg Rainer Hofmann (born November 10, 1961 in Rimhorn , Odenwald ) is a German computer scientist, professor and director of the Information Management Institute at the Technical University in Aschaffenburg .

Career

After studying computer science, minor subjects in economics and philosophy, at the Technical University of Darmstadt , he obtained his doctorate in 1991 under José Luis Encarnação ( TU Darmstadt ) and Peter Stucki ( University of Zurich ) on the technical-philosophical subject of "Naturalism in Computer Graphics".

From 1987 to 1992 he was a research associate and department head at the Fraunhofer Institute for Computer Graphics in Darmstadt. From 1993 to 1996 he was a consultant (authorized signatory) at KPMG Unternehmensberatung GmbH in Frankfurt am Main and Berlin. He has been a professor at Aschaffenburg University since 1996.

From 1999 to 2009 he was a lecturer in the master's degree in "Business Information Systems" at the University of Liechtenstein and from 1995 to 2017 he was a lecturer in the MBA course in "Business Integration" at the Julius Maximilians University of Würzburg .

Hofmann is spokesman for the “Software and Service Market” specialist group of the Society for Information Technology eV and spokesman for the “E-Commerce” competence group of eco - Association of the Internet Industry eV

He is a member of the supervisory board of CAPCom AG, Darmstadt.

Research topics

Hofmann pursues a critical-rational discourse of the analysis of directly relevant questions of corporate management and their interaction with technical, social and ethical questions.
